► Chapters 00:00 Solid & Aggressive Chess Opening for Black 00:30 Petrov's Defence or Russian Game 00:54 Aggressive and Unknown Sideline 02:01 White's inaccuracy giving Black an outpost 04:22 White's only aggressive attempt fails 06:22 If White plays h3, attacking Bg4 09:41 If White plays Re1, attacking Ke8 11:18 Question for you: can Black play this move? 12:42 White's correct move: c4 14:30 Tip: Better diagonal for your bishop

*f5! is GOOD and the best continuation:* A) if *Qxg7* then *Ne2+ Rxe2* (if Kf1 Qd1#) *Qd1+ Re1 Qxe1#* B) if *Rxd4* then *fxg4 Rxd8 Rxd8* and now after *Nc3 O-O* White is up the exchange and is winning C) if *Qh5+* then *g6 Rxd4 Qxd4 Qf3 O-O-O* and again White is winning
